Originally Posted by cobalt
What is the color? Seems to be a green gray

Stunning car and nicely captured, The backdrop sets everything off and it checks all the boxes. What suspension?
Thanks Cobalt!

All I had on me was my phone, kind of wish I brought my camera but it was a spur of the moment trip. Weather was decent and I wanted to burn off a bit of fuel before I filled it up and added a bit of sta-bil for the winter.

I had the car resprayed Olive Green Metallic from the first gen Cayenne. It's really wild the way the color changes depending on light. Here in the shade it looks grayish but if you look back a few pages I have a photo where it's in morning sunlight and it looks completely different. And the wheel color was stolen from a GT3. I wanted to make the car different but still keep it in the Porsche color tree family.

The suspension is H&R "deep" coilovers. They came with the car when I bought it a few years ago but I'm still not completely sold on them. I'm probably midway height wise and they're just a bit too firm for me. As I'm getting older, I'm finding myself wanting a little softer ride. Still firm and planted but a little bit more subdued then these. I've been toying with the idea of selling them (they only have around 10-15k miles) and picking up a set of KW v1 or something of the sort but I like where I have the car height now. My delima now is to decide if the ride will be better with these in the middle of the height adjustability or another set near the bottom of the adjustability. The car is never tracked but does see some tight windy country roads

​​​​​​That is where I recognize the color from. My wife wanted a cayenne in this color but ended up with beige. Hard to say but I am assuming you are running RS or RS-10mm. If you plan to run this height I would keep what you have. The K1's will probably be more harsh and to do it better will cost much more. I would consider 993 GT2evo uprights instead.
